The World Liberty Financial USD (USD1) stablecoin linked to the family of US President Donald Trump gained $150 million in market capitalization on Wednesday after Binance announced a yield program centered around the token. The stablecoin’s market capitalization climbed from $2.74 billion to $2.89 billion on Wednesday after Binance announced its “booster program,” offering up to 20% annual percentage rate (APR) on USD1 flexible products for deposits exceeding $50,000. Bitcoin Holds the Line Near $87K as Indicators Send Mixed Holiday Signals
Bitcoin’s price on Wednesday stands at $87,234, with a market capitalization of $1.74 trillion, reflecting a cautious tone heading into Christmas Eve as 24-hour trading volume clocks in at $36.90 billion and the intraday range stays boxed between $86,713 and $88,091. The Macro Conditions For Bitcoin In 2026
Macro trader plur daddy (@plur_daddy) argues bitcoin’s 2026 setup is less about crypto-specific catalysts and more about whether US liquidity conditions normalize after what he described as an unusually tight few months for risk. Bitcoin Logs 4th Straight Outflow Day With $189 Million Exit
Bitcoin ETFs posted a fourth consecutive day of outflows, while ether ETFs slipped back into the red. XRP and solana ETFs continued to attract modest but steady inflows, underscoring selective investor demand. Kraken IPO, M&A Deals Reignite Crypto’s ‘Mid-Stage’ Cycle: Fund Manager
A potential initial public offering (IPO) next year by cryptocurrency exchange Kraken may attract fresh capital from traditional finance (TradFi) investors. Bitcoin recorded an all-time high price above $126,000 on Oct. 6, but hasn’t recovered from a $19 billion liquidation event that hit the industry a few days later. At the time of writing, the world’s largest cryptocurrency was trading at $87,015 per coin, down 6% in two weeks, according to CoinGecko.
